At the moment, I continue to hold all my positions and even raised the ranges for the bots located at the upper boundary. I did not add new funds to the bots, but shifted the upper boundary by shifting the entire range upward, i.e., the lower boundary also became higher. Although this approach does not require new funds at the moment, in case of a market decline, more funds will be needed to maintain the position. My overall debt level is currently around 2%, so there should be no problems with holding positions.
